Chinese APT Hackers Exploit Microsoft Exchange to Breach Energy Sector

Quick Takeaways

  1. A Chinese state-linked hacking group, FamousSparrow, exploited unpatched Microsoft Exchange servers in Azerbaijan’s energy sector from Dec 2025 to Feb 2026, deploying sophisticated malware and multiple backdoors for sustained espionage.
  2. The attack involved exploiting ProxyNotShell vulnerabilities to inject web shells, establishing persistent footholds through layered malware like Deed RAT and Terndoor, and employing advanced DLL sideloading techniques that evade automated detection.
  3. The campaign demonstrated multi-wave persistence, with attackers repeatedly revisiting the compromised server, swapping malware families, and attempting kernel-level insertion, indicating deliberate, ongoing espionage targeting critical energy infrastructure.
  4. Security experts advise immediate patching of Exchange servers, credential rotation, and monitoring for malicious web shell activity, suspicious RDP sessions, and unauthorized outbound connections to detect and prevent further intrusions.

The Core Issue

Between late December 2025 and late February 2026, a Chinese state-linked hacking group known as FamousSparrow orchestrated a sophisticated attack on an Azerbaijani oil and gas company. The attackers exploited an unpatched Microsoft Exchange server using the ProxyNotShell vulnerability, which allowed them to implant web shells and establish persistent access. This espionage operation deployed multiple backdoor families, including Deed RAT and Terndoor, through a layered and evolving malware chain. Significantly, the group demonstrated advanced evasion techniques, such as DLL sideloading with multi-stage logic that concealed malicious activity until specific execution conditions were met. Researchers at Bitdefender identified this campaign as a deliberate, multi-wave effort aimed at energy infrastructure, especially given Azerbaijan’s increasing role as a European gas supplier after disruptions elsewhere. The attack signals a highly targeted, sustained cyber-espionage effort aimed at intelligence gathering rather than immediate disruption, with security experts urging prompt patching and vigilant monitoring of suspicious activities to prevent further breaches.

The intrusion primarily affected the Azerbaijani energy sector, with the threat group returning multiple times to maintain access and evade detection. They targeted sensitive network components and used cleverly disguised malware files, such as encrypted payloads and legitimate-looking binaries, to evade security measures. The report, published by Bitdefender, attributes the attack to FamousSparrow with moderate to high confidence, linking it to broader Chinese intelligence operations focused on critical energy infrastructure in the South Caucasus. The report emphasizes the importance of applying all relevant security patches, rotating exposed credentials, and closely monitoring for signs of unauthorized RDP sessions, PowerShell activity, and anomalous outbound traffic—steps critical to safeguarding national energy assets from ongoing cyber espionage threats.

Risks Involved

The Chinese APT hackers’ attack on Microsoft Exchange illustrates a dangerous threat that can target any business, including yours. When hackers exploit vulnerabilities in widely used software like Exchange, they can gain access to your network without detection. This breach can lead to sensitive data theft, operational disruptions, or even financial losses. Moreover, once inside, attackers often move laterally, expanding their reach and increasing damage. Therefore, any business relying on digital communication systems faces significant risk if cybersecurity measures are not up to date. This incident underscores the importance of continuous security vigilance, timely patches, and robust monitoring—because, in today’s interconnected world, no company is immune to such sophisticated cyber threats.

Possible Actions

Prompted by the significant threat posed by Chinese APT hackers exploiting Microsoft Exchange to infiltrate energy sector networks, timely remediation becomes critical to prevent extensive damage, data loss, and operational disruption. Rapid response curtails malicious activities, limits access, and restores secure operations efficiently.

Containment Measures
Implement immediate isolation of affected systems to prevent lateral movement of malicious actors. Disconnect compromised servers and network segments from the internet and internal networks.

Vulnerability Patching
Deploy the latest security updates and patches provided by Microsoft to address known Exchange vulnerabilities. Regularly review and apply patches swiftly when released.

Threat Hunt
Conduct thorough investigations to identify signs of intrusion or malicious artifacts, focusing on unusual activity, backdoors, or unauthorized access credentials.

Access Control
Enforce strict access controls, including multi-factor authentication, to restrict administrative privileges and prevent unauthorized access.

Monitoring and Detection
Increase surveillance with advanced intrusion detection system (IDS) signatures and security information and event management (SIEM) tools to identify ongoing or past malicious activities swiftly.

Communication Protocols
Notify relevant security teams, stakeholders, and authorities about the breach, enabling coordinated responses and information sharing.

System Restoration
Remove malicious components, restore affected systems from clean backups, and verify integrity before bringing systems back online.

User Awareness
Educate personnel about phishing attempts and suspicious activities to prevent user-assisted infiltration.

Review and Strengthen
Post-incident, analyze the breach to understand weaknesses and enhance security policies, including intrusion prevention systems and incident response plans, to mitigate future risks.
